- Born Oct. 9, 1925
As scouting and player development director of the Baltimore Orioles (1976โ87) he drafted Hall of Fame shortstop Cal Ripken Jr., and signed and developed other players who would help Baltimore win the 1983 World Series.\n', '
Giordano was born in Newark, New Jersey. Nicknamed "T-Bone", as a player he stood 6 feet (1.8 metres) tall and weighed 175 pounds (79ย kg) and threw and batted right-handed. Apart from his 11-game trial with the 1953 Athletics, when he batted .175 with seven hits (four for extra bases), he spent his entire uniformed career in the minors. In 1956 he became a playing manager for the Milwaukee Braves\' organization, then returned to the Athletics (based by then in Kansas City) two years later as a minor league manager. In 1960 Giordano became a scout, working for the Athletics, Cincinnati Reds, Cleveland Indians, Seattle Pilots/Milwaukee Brewers and the Orioles. He was a longtime associate of late Orioles and Indians executive Hank Peters and former Braves\' president, baseball operations John Hart.\n', '
From 1976 he was a senior scouting or player development executive or assistant to the general manager for the Orioles, Indians (1987โ2000) and Texas Rangers (2001โ15). He was named Major League Baseball\'s East Coast Scout of the Year in 2007 in a vote of his peers. Giordano died on February 14, 2019 at the age of 93.\n', '
